Umm Salal is a football club based in Al-Khor, Qatar, playing their home matches at Al-Khwar Stadium. Follow Umm Salal on FotMob for live match updates, detailed statistics, squad information, transfer news, and comprehensive performance analytics.

Oussama Tannane leads Umm Salal's scoring in league play with 9 goals this season. Cristo González has contributed 7, while Antonio Mance has added 6.

Umm Salal have been in a difficult spell recently, winning 0 of their last 5 matches (0% win rate). They have scored 7 goals and conceded 14 during this period. However, defensive frailties have been a concern, conceding an average of 2.8 goals per game. In the QSL Cup, they faced a 3-3 draw with Al-Rayyan. In the Qatar Stars League, they faced a 2-3 loss to Al-Shamal, a 0-3 loss to Al-Rayyan, and a 1-3 loss to Al-Ahli. In the Amir of Qatar Cup, they faced a 1-2 loss to Al-Gharafa.

Umm Salal currently sits in 12th place in the Qatar Stars League with 20 points from 22 matches (6W 2D 14L).

Umm Salal's squad consists of 35 players. Goalkeepers: Louay Ashour (Qatar), Landing Badji (Senegal), Jehad Mohammad Hudib (Qatar), Rami Hamada (Palestine), Ahmad Ismail Ahmad (Qatar). Defenders: Abdulrahman Faiz Al Rashidi (Qatar), Abdalaziz Al Hasia (Qatar), Sayed Hassan Issa (Qatar), Waleed El Bahnasawi (Qatar), Adil Tahif (Morocco), Naïm Laidouni (Algeria), Ali Hassan Afif (Qatar), Khalifa Al Malki (Qatar), Edidiong Essien (Nigeria), Edidiong Udosen (Nigeria), Issoufou Dayo (Burkina Faso), Diyab Haroon (Qatar), Mohamed Omer Suliman (Qatar), Abdou Diallo (Senegal). Midfielders: Nasser Al Ahrak (Qatar), Fares Said (Qatar), Jean-Eudes Aholou (Côte d'Ivoire), Khaled Waleed (Qatar), Salem Al Hajri (Qatar), Michael Baidoo (Ghana), Oussama Tannane (Morocco), Yamaan Jarrar (Qatar), Amjad Mustafa (Qatar), Ahmed El Sayed (Qatar), Mahdi Salem (Qatar). Forwards: Antonio Mance (Croatia), Meshaal Al Shammari (Qatar), Jean Kouassi (Côte d'Ivoire), Cristo González (Spain), Mohamed Khaled (Qatar).

Umm Salal transfers: New signings include Adil Tahif (from RSB Berkane). Players transferred out include Marouane Louadni (to FAR Rabat).

Rubén Albés is the current head coach of Umm Salal. Under their leadership, the team has achieved a 38% win rate across 8 matches, averaging 1.38 points per game.

Notable previous managers include Patrice Carteron managed the club for 3 seasons, recording 13 wins from 44 matches (30% win rate). Pablo Machín managed the club for one season, recording 1 win from 3 matches (33% win rate). Other former coaches include Patrice Beaumelle, Raúl Caneda, Laurent Banide, and Bülent Uygun.

Umm Salal plays their home matches at Al-Khwar Stadium in Al-Khor, which has a capacity of 45,330.
